Stakes are high in Bern

Switzerland and Iceland meet at the Stadion Wankdorf on Sunday in a crucial Women’s Euro 2025 Group A clash.

Host nation Switzerland opened the scoring against Norway in their tournament opener but slipped to a 2-1 defeat, while Iceland went down 1-0 to Finland.

A second defeat for either side here would all-but end any hopes of reaching the knockout stages and both of these teams come into the game in poor form.

Home advantage gives Switzerland the edge and they were arguably unlucky not to claim at least a point against the Norwegians. A win for the hosts nation is one option but the standout bet here looks to be backing both teams to score as both defences look suspect.

Iceland have conceded in six of their last seven games, while the Swiss have conceded in each of their last seven. That run includes a 3-3 draw between these two sides in Iceland in the Nations League back in April.

Both of these sides are in poor form as Switzerland have seven defeats in 10 and Iceland have won just one of their last 12. As such picking a winner is tricky here but the Swiss did impress at various stages against Norway and their recent defeats have all come against a high standard of opponent. With home advantage, they may be able to claim the points and a 2-1 win for the host nation is the correct score pick.
